摘要:
已知p指向双向循环链表中的一个结点,其结点结构为data、prior、next三个域,实现交换p所指向的结点和它的前缀结点的顺序。 #include<iostream>#include<cstring>using namespace std;typedef struct f{ int data; f 阅读全文
摘要:
7-1 线性表A,B顺序存储合并 有两张非递增有序的线性表A,B,采用顺序存储结构,两张表合并用c表存,要求C为非递减有序的,然后删除C表中值相同的多余元素。元素类型为整型 #include<iostream>#include<cstring>using namespace std;typedef 阅读全文
摘要:
struct ListNode *reverse(struct ListNode *head){ if(head==NULL||head->next==NULL) { return head; } struct ListNode *p=NULL,*t,*pp=head; while(pp) { t= 阅读全文
摘要:
程序员修炼之道:从小工到专家。在第五章中,作者强调了代码质量的重要性。他提到,优秀的程序员应当追求可读性、可维护性和可扩展性的代码。这一点对我来说是一个很大的提醒,因为在日常工作中,我们往往面临着繁杂的业务需求和紧迫的时间压力,很容易忽视代码质量的重要性。然而,经过作者详细的解释和实例,我意识到高质 阅读全文
摘要:
读完《程序员修炼之道:从小工到专家》的第三章和第四章后,我不禁被这本书所揭示的思维方式和工作方法所震撼。这两章的内容围绕着软件开发过程中的团队合作、沟通和管理等方面展开,不仅直指开发中的痛点,还给出了实用的解决方案和建议。 在第三章中,作者强调了团队中的每个成员都要成为一个“顶尖专家”,即熟悉公司的 阅读全文